/*stylefortemplate#0*/
body{background:#FF8C0A;}
body,form,p,ul{margin:0;padding:0;}
body,input,select,td,textarea{color:#300000; font-family:Tahoma;font-size:11px;}
a{color:#300000; text-decoration:underline;}
a:hover{text-decoration:none;}
h1{font-size:17px; color:black;}
h3{font-size:15px; color:black;}
h4{font-size:14px; color:black;}
h6{font-size:12px; color:#CF0101;}
img,table{border:0 none;}


.header_till{background:url(images/header_till.jpg) left top repeat-x; height:179px; width:100%;}

.header_left{background:url(images/header_left.jpg) left top no-repeat;}

.header_center{background:url(images/header_center.jpg) center bottom no-repeat; vertical-align:top;}
	
	.menu{background:url(images/menu_bg.gif) left top no-repeat; display:table; height:35px; line-height:28px; text-align:center; width:616px;}
	.menu a{font-weight:bold; margin:0 8px;}

.header_right{background:url(images/header_right.jpg) left top no-repeat;}

.left{background:url(images/left_bg.jpg) left top repeat-y; height:100%; vertical-align:top; width:179px;}

	.left_bg2{background:url(images/left_bg2.jpg) left top no-repeat;}

	.cat_center{background:url(images/cat_center.jpg) left 59px no-repeat; margin-left:-13px;}
	.cat_center ul{margin-left:13px;}
	.cat_center1{background:url(images/cat_center1.jpg) left 59px no-repeat; margin-left:-13px;}
	.cat_center1 ul{margin-left:13px;}

	.categories,.sub_categories{line-height:18px; list-style:none; margin:1px 0;}
	.categories a,.sub_categories a{text-decoration:none;}
	.categories a:hover,.sub_categories a:hover{text-decoration:underline;}
	
	.categories{background:url(images/dot.gif) left center no-repeat; font-weight:bold; padding-left:10px;}
	
	.sub_categories{padding-left:20px;}
	
	.sort{line-height:18px;}
	
	.cart{font-weight:bold;}
	.cart a{font-size:10px;}
	
	.currency{background:url(images/currency_bg.jpg) left top no-repeat; height:67px; vertical-align:top;}
	.currency form{margin:36px 0 0 7px;}
	
.main_td{background:#FEECCA url(images/ccf.gif) left bottom repeat-x; border-top:1px solid #C17F00;}
	
		.clh{background:url(images/clh.gif) left top no-repeat; border:1px solid #300000;}
		.crh{background:url(images/crh.gif) right top no-repeat; vertical-align:top;}
		
		.clf{background:url(images/clf.gif) left bottom no-repeat;}
		.crf{background:url(images/crf.gif) right bottom no-repeat; padding:12px 18px; vertical-align:top;}

.right{background:url(images/right_bg.jpg) left top repeat-y; height:100%; vertical-align:top; width:188px;}
	
	.search{background:url(images/search_bg.jpg) left top no-repeat; height:75px; vertical-align:top;}
	.search form{margin:27px 0 0 22px;}
	.search input{vertical-align:middle;}
	.search_input{background:#FFFFFF; border:1px solid #331E08; padding-left:4px; width:108px;}
	*html .search_checkbox{margin:-2px -2px 0 0;}
	
	.phone{background:url(images/phone_bg.jpg) left top no-repeat; font-size:12px; height:65px; padding-left:44px;}
	.phone strong{font-family:Arial; font-size:13px;}

	.login{background:url(images/login_bg.jpg) left top no-repeat; height:100px; padding-left:20px; vertical-align:top;}
	.login form{margin-top:24px;}
	.login input{vertical-align:middle;}
	.login_input{background:#FFFFFF; border:1px solid #331E08; margin:2px 0; padding-left:4px; width:110px;}
	
	table.news{margin-left:12px;}
	.news a{font-weight:bold;}
	.news form a{font-weight:normal;}
	.news input{vertical-align:middle;}

.footer{background:url(images/ft.gif) left top repeat-x; height:100%; padding:10px 0; text-align:center; vertical-align:top;}
.footer a{font-weight:bold;}
.footer p{margin-bottom:8px;}
.footer p a{margin:0 8px;}



.c_td{background:url(images/c_td.gif) left top repeat-y; padding-left:13px;}
.c_td2{background:url(images/c_td2.gif) left top repeat-y; padding:0 8px;}

.fh{height:100%;}

.fw{width:100%;}
.fw2{width:50%;}

.gl{background:url(images/px.gif) left 6px repeat-x; margin:0 -6px; text-align:right;}

.title{font-size:14px; font-weight:bold;}

.td_separator{height:5px;}

.no_underline{text-decoration:none;}

.small{font-size:9px;}

.faq{font-size:14px;}

.faq_gray{font-size:14px; color:#666666;}

.faq_olive{font-size:14px; color:#3A6135;}

.big{font-size:16px; text-decoration:none;}

.cat{font-size:14px;}

.standard{font-weight:normal;}

.standardsmall{font-weight:normal; font-size:9px;}

.light{color:white;}

.lightsmall{color:white; font-size:9px;}

.middle{color:#F0B5B5;}

.olive{color:#163106; font-weight:normal; font-size:9px;}

.totalPrice{font-size:16px; border:0 none; margin:1px; font-weight:bold; color:red; background-color:transparent;}

.myaccount_tab_bottom{BORDER-BOTTOM:1px solid; BORDER-LEFT:0px solid; BORDER-RIGHT:1px solid; BORDER-TOP:0px solid; BORDER-COLOR:#82A1DD; text-align:center; margin:1px;}

.myaccount_tab_top{BORDER-BOTTOM:0px solid; BORDER-LEFT:0px solid; BORDER-RIGHT:1px solid; BORDER-TOP:1px solid; BORDER-COLOR:#82A1DD; text-align:center; margin:1px;}

.myAccount_bottomright{BORDER-BOTTOM:1px dotted #A9C0FF; BORDER-RIGHT:1px dotted #A9C0FF;}

.myAccount_bottom{BORDER-BOTTOM:1px dotted #A9C0FF;}

.myAccount_right{BORDER-RIGHT:1px dotted #A9C0FF;}

.comparison_button{background-color:#D2E7FF; border:1px solid;}

.pageSeparator{BORDER-BOTTOM:2px dotted #A9C0FF;}